NEW YORK, Jan. 26 (Xinhua) -- A 5.7-magnitude earthquake jolted 61km W of Amatignak Island, Alaska at 22:33:40 GMT on Sunday, the U.S. Geological Survey said.

The epicenter, with a depth of 35.0 km, was initially determined to be at 51.3133 degrees north latitude and 179.9871 degrees west longitude.
